Transfer News: Stuttgart Faces Exit Threats, Frankfurt Secures Goalkeeper

The European football landscape is shifting as clubs prepare for the upcoming season. VfB Stuttgart is navigating potential player departures while also eyeing new acquisitions. Simultaneously, Eintracht Frankfurt is solidifying its goalkeeping position, with ripples extending to Werder Bremen. Here’s a breakdown of the latest transfer developments.

Stuttgart’s Balancing Act: Holding onto Stars, Seeking Reinforcements

VfB Stuttgart’s sporting director, Alexander Wehrle, is actively working to retain key players amid notable interest from other clubs. The club recently turned down a bid of 20 million euros from Nottingham Forest for winger Jamie Leweling. Simultaneously, Bayern Munich reportedly made a 60 million euro offer for forward Nick Woltemade, which was also rejected. Stuttgart appears resolute to maintain the core of its triumphant squad.

However, the situation is less secure for Memedin Demirovic. The attacker,currently behind Deniz Undav in the pecking order,is reportedly unhappy with his limited role. english Championship side Leeds United has expressed interest in Demirovic, and Stuttgart is bracing for a potential 40 million euro bid.

New Targets for Sebastian Hoeneß

VfB Stuttgart manager Sebastian Hoeneß is seeking to bolster his offensive options. The anticipated arrival of Tiago Tomas is expected to strengthen the attack. scouts are also assessing other potential additions, including andy Diouf, a central midfielder from RC Lens. However, Napoli is considered the frontrunner for Diouf’s signature.

A more focused target for Stuttgart is Gustavo Sa, a 20-year-old playmaker currently with Portuguese club Famalicao. Sa’s contract with Famalicao extends until 2029, perhaps complicating negotiations.

Goalkeeper Shuffle: Zetterer to Frankfurt, Baum Potential Bremen Bound

Eintracht Frankfurt is on the verge of securing Werder Bremen goalkeeper Michael Zetterer as a replacement for kevin Trapp, who is set to join Paris Saint-Germain. The transfer fee is expected to be around 4.5 million euros. Zetterer has already bid farewell to his Bremen teammates and is undergoing a medical in Frankfurt. Trapp is simultaneously completing his medical with PSG, ensuring a swift completion of both deals.

Werder Bremen, meanwhile, is looking to add depth at right-back and has identified Elias Baum of Eintracht Frankfurt as a potential target. Bremen is hoping to secure a loan deal for Baum, who recently excelled under new Werder coach Horst Steffen at SV Elversberg.Frankfurt has yet to decide whether to loan Baum or retain him as competition for rasmus Kristensen.

Understanding the transfer Window

The transfer window,typically spanning several months during the summer and a shorter period in January,is a crucial time for football clubs to reshape their squads. The rules governing transfers have evolved substantially in recent years, with stricter regulations aimed at promoting financial sustainability. According to UEFA, clubs must adhere to break-even rules and demonstrate long-term financial stability to participate in European competitions.

The dynamics of the transfer market are influenced by factors such as player performance,contract expiry dates,and the overall financial health of clubs. Negotiations frequently enough involve complex discussions regarding transfer fees, player wages, and potential bonuses. The rise of agents and intermediaries has also added another layer of complexity to the process.

frequently Asked Questions About Football Transfers

  • What is a transfer fee? A transfer fee is the amount of money a club pays to acquire a player from another club.
  • What is a loan transfer? A loan transfer allows a player to join another club temporarily,usually for a set period,with the parent club retaining ownership.
  • What is Financial Fair Play? Financial Fair Play (FFP) is a set of regulations implemented by UEFA to promote financial stability in European football.
  • How do agents influence transfers? Agents represent players and negotiate contracts on their behalf, frequently enough playing a key role in facilitating transfers.
  • What happens when a player’s contract expires? When a player’s contract expires, they become a free agent and can join another club without a transfer fee.
  • Are transfer rumors always accurate? No, transfer rumors are often speculative and should be treated with caution until officially confirmed.
  • What is a medical check? A medical check is a comprehensive physical examination that clubs conduct to ensure a player is fit to play before completing a transfer.
